WebThe Great Pacific Garbage Patch is a zone in the Pacific Ocean between Hawaii and California where plastic waste has accumulated. The size of the garbage patch is difficult to measure because the debris constantly moves. However, a major study in 2024 compared the extent of the garbage patch to twice the size of the U.S. state of Texas.
